As you are aware, A.B. 2683, the California legislation that would repeal the state's current rolling emissions test exemption for vehicles 30 years old and older passed in the California Assembly and will now be considered in the Senate. The bill would repeal the current pro-hobbyist exemption and replace it with a law requiring the permanent testing of all 1976 and newer model vehicles. A hearing in the Senate will likely be scheduled for June 29th. We must double our efforts to contact the Senate Transportation Committee!

I agree with the Harley part, bu the old school american cars get a free pass because, well, they are old. They were never ment to pass any smog laws when new, and none used cats untill '75, so it would be unfair to make them pass now. It's not just American cars that get a free pass, it's any car built before 1976. My neighbor used to have a 50 something Mercedes-Benz and he was always talking about how thankfull he was for the law. What about all of the bugs. How many of those do you think have o pass smog? I'm not saying I like the idea of doing away with the 30+years stipulation, just saying that American cars don't have an unfair advantage.
